Essential Responsibilities and Duties:
- Verify order specifications pull orders move materials package materials process shipping documentation and other activities to prepare product for shipment.
- Perform material transactions confirm and carry out shipping instructions within quality standards.
- Maintain inventory supermarkets and controlling transactions of material leaving supermarkets and reporting variances.
- Maintain or exceed the approved rate of production.
- Move transfer and relocate inventory materials or supplies as directed by supervision.
- Set up and operate equipment related to preparation for and shipment of units and parts for all product lines.
- Set up and operate equipment related to receipt of shipments.
- Monitor inventory of supplies and advise supervision of anticipated requirements.
- Wash and paint pumps and components in accordance with existing guidelines.
- Stage and prepare all shipments and stock orders with accuracy.
- Maintain acceptable attendance record acceptable overall work record and purchase the required tools for the classification.
- Report defective materials or questionable conditions per established processes.
- Maintain the work area and equipment in a clean and orderly condition and follow 5S and safety regulations.
- Perform light preventative maintenance and housekeeping duties for areas and equipment in assigned work center.
- Complete tasks as directed by manufacturing schedules with minimum supervision.
- Perform other related duties as deemed necessary by the Supervision or Management.
Job Knowledge Skills and Abilities:
- Thorough knowledge of parts parts handling and quality control requirements.
- Ability to work independently exhibit the ability to solve problems without assistance and demonstrate effective communication skills both verbal and written.
- Must have proven mechanical clerical and mathematical abilities necessary for safe equipment operation and accurate recording of data.
- Demonstrated ability to adhere to standardized safety policies and operating practices.
- Knowledge of current MRP system.
- Knowledge of product structure and material pull systems.
Training Requirements:
- General Safety
- ISO 9001
- ISO 14000
- Applicable FOPs
- Current Fork Truck certification
- Affected employee lock out tag out training.
Personal Protective Equipment:
- Safety glasses
- Steel toe shoes
- May require other PPE such as gloves goggles shields aprons etc while performing specific tasks
Working Environment and Physical Demands:
- May require specialized training and demonstrate competency in MRP and other related business software.
- Work performed in a nonairconditioned shop environment.
- Exposure to shop environment such as noise dust odors and fumes.
- May work at different workstations as production needs require.
- Standing entire shift.
- Lift up to 50 lbs.
- Bending and stooping throughout shift.
- Ability to operate material handling equipment such as hoist positioners pallet jacks fork trucks etc.
- Must be able to lift push and pull materials and equipment to complete assigned tasks.
